Output 151b65eb351d643409850947c53bbc169a3a64e1e0219d7a2689a47603b2b69e:5

value
16913125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e666a2403d4146c9d56cb5802e8f9b042b5fdff OP_EQUAL
address
MC8W19Sga1fPLHiWjU54GHC8Z4y5H6LWPt
transaction
151b65eb351d643409850947c53bbc169a3a64e1e0219d7a2689a47603b2b69e
spent
true